I've just installed tomcat 3.2.1 and its working fine except that I am using
the default webapps/examples directory to store my servlets which is a pain
as I physically have to copy them over etc and I would like to keep them on
a seperate folder somewhere else on my machine.
I have been trying to achieve this by adding a contex-path to the server.xml
file with no luck. Currently my servlets are in
H:\jakarta-tomcat-3.2.1\webapps\examples\WEB-INF\classes and I would like to
store them in
H:\Work\MyServlets\bin
I cannot work out how to change this directory this is as far as I have
got:-
<Context path="/myservlets"
docBase="../../Work/MyServlets/bin"
crossContext="false"
debug="0"
reloadable="true" >
</Context>
This does not work and I cannot work out why!
